大部分DBMS提供数据定义语言DDL(Data Definition Language)和数据操作语言DML(Data Manipulation Language),供用户定义数据库的模式结构与权限约束,实现对数据的追加、删除等操作。 理解:数据是存在数据库中的,数据库理解为一个个单独的文件组成的,文件中存储数据。DBMS 对其进行管理,实现我们通常说的CRUD 操作,当然还有...
DBMS的主要功能包括: 数据定义语言(DDL):用于定义数据库中的对象,例如表、索引和视图等。 数据操作语言(DML):用于插入、更新、删除和查询数据。 数据控制语言(DCL):用于控制对数据库内容的访问权限和安全性。 事务管理:确保数据库中的所有操作都可以被正确地提交或回滚,以避免数据丢失或不一致。 并发控制:确保多个...
2. DML(Data Manipulation Language):数据操作语言,用来定义数据库记录(数据); >增、删、改:表记录 3. DCL(Data Control Language):数据控制语言,用来定义访问权限和安全级别; 4. DQL***(Data Query Language):数据查询语言,用来查询记录(数据)。 ddl:数据库或表的结构操作(***) dml:对表的记录进行更新(...
百度试题 结果1 题目DDL是指___,DML是指___,DBMS是指___,DD是指___。相关知识点: 试题来源: 解析 数据描述语言 数据操纵-查询语言 数据库管理系统 数据字典 反馈 收藏
数据定义子系统是DBMS中非常重要的一部分,负责定义和管理数据库的结构。它主要包括数据定义语言(DDL)和数据字典。DDL用于创建、修改和删除数据库中的对象,例如表、视图和索引。数据字典则是存储关于数据库中所有对象的元数据的地方。这包括对象的名称、类型、大小、所有者和其他属性。
DBMS作用?每个角色对应内容?数据组的产品和社会?SQL种类?DML、DDL、DCL基本命令是?DDL用于定义和管理...
DDL命令会影响整个数据库或表,但DML命令会影响表中的一个或多个记录。 4、回滚上的区别 带有DDL命令的SQL语句无法回滚;带有DML命令的SQL语句可以回滚。 结论: 为了形成数据库语言,DDL和DML都是必需的。DDL和DML之间的主要区别在于:DDL有助于更改数据库的结构,而DML有助于管理数据库中的数据。
数据定义语言(DDL):用于定义数据库结构,如表、索引等。 数据操纵语言(DML):用于对数据库中的数据进行查询、插入、更新和删除等操作。 数据控制语言(DCL):用于控制用户对数据库的访问权限。 三、数据库管理系统的分类 根据不同的分类标准,DBMS可以分为多种类型。常见的分类方式有以下几种: 关系型数据库管理系统(...
数据库管理系统DBMS是一种专门用于管理和处理数据库的软件。它是一个接口,允许用户或应用程序创建、检索、更新和管理数据库的数据。DBMS主要包括数据定义语言DDL、数据操作语言DML、数据控制语言DCL,还包括一些特性,如数据安全性、数据完整性、数据一致性、数据恢复、并发控制、数据字典管理等。
DML:数据库操作语言(select, delete, update) DDL:数据库定义语言(create, drop) DCL:数据库控制语言 数据库存储和执行框架: 2.2记录的磁盘存储: 单调记录存储 非跨块存储:浪费一些空间,但磁盘之间无关联,可并行 跨块存储:磁盘之间有关联,不可并行